For the love of the village: Butcher Rottman Bürge shows new Volg village stories

The Volg advertising campaign by MRB Metzger Rottmann Bürge is entering its second year. The campaign is intended to ensure that Volg can rapidly increase its profile as a customer-oriented retailer.

In addition to the village stories from the first year of the campaign, which were implemented as scalable content on posters, in advertisements, as photo or video stories or as publicity reports, further episodes from the Volg villages are now being added.

In the continuation of the campaign, you can find out "where every sausage drives a snowmobile", "where people let the pig out" or "where it still really stinks in the village", to quote just three of the ten new village stories.

In addition, two new TV commercials are designed to attract attention. The TV commercial "Grandpa" shows with a smile how well the Volg store employees know and appreciate their customers - even if they unfortunately only arrive after closing time. And the TV commercial "Romeo & Juliet" heartwarmingly reveals that you can find love for life while shopping at Volg.

In addition, there are now also branded checkout conveyor belt dividers in the store, which are designed to provide entertainment with short anecdotes in a playful and product-oriented way.

All advertising materials are in use immediately and throughout the year.
